stories-alive-logoAuryn, Inc., the most award-winning digital publisher of children’s apps, announced today the release of StoriesAlive (www.stories-alive.com), Auryn’s first subscription-based library app for children ages 3 to 8. StoriesAlive offers families an easy and affordable way to enjoy Auryn’s award-winning collection of hundreds of stories that engage, entertain and encourage learning among young readers. Kids can delight in a thoughtfully procured collection of stories from treasured classics and favorite fairytales to modern day bestsellers from renowned children’s book authors. This includes critically-acclaimed stories such as What Does My Teddy Bear Do All Day? and Alphabet Animals, winners of Parent’s Choice and Appy awards and “Best of” Kirkus Reviews.stories alive

StoriesAlive is FREE to download on iPad and Android tablets and comes with six FREE-trial stories. But for $7.99 per month, children can access hundreds of interactive stories; new stories are added on a weekly basis, including premium story apps, for an ever-expanding library. Once a story is downloaded, an Internet connection is not needed, making StoriesAlive perfect for on-the-go families or for cuddling and reading at bedtime.
